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Buffy-headed Marmoset | Ciervo de Eld |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(cordados) | Chordata (cordados) |
| Class same | Mammalia (mamíferos) | Mammalia (mamíferos)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Artiodactyla (artiodáctilos) |
| Family | Callitrichidae | Cervidae (Deer) |
| Genus | Callithrix | Rucervus |
| Species | Callithrix flaviceps | Rucervus eldii |
Evolutionary Relationship
Buffy-headed Marmoset and Ciervo de Eld share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(mamíferos)
